Historic District

Charleston Historic District Map

At the heart of Charleston lies its Historic District, an area characterized by antebellum mansions and cobblestone streets. Each turn unveils another layer of cultural heritage, with elegant homes such as the Battery and Rainbow Row standing as testament to the city’s storied past. Strolling through this district feels akin to wandering through an enchanting time capsule, where architecture and history intermingle seamlessly.

Coastal Splendor

Charleston Coastal Attractions Map

The natural beauty surrounding Charleston is truly breathtaking. The coastal landscapes, adorned with salt marshes and sun-kissed beaches, provide a picturesque backdrop for outdoor enthusiasts. Folly Beach and Sullivan’s Island, both known for their tranquil shorelines, invite visitors to participate in water sports or simply savor the serene ambiance. The juxtaposition of the ocean with the city’s historical charm creates a singular experience, embodying the spirit of the Lowcountry.

Botanical Gardens

Charleston Botanical Gardens Map

Charleston’s botanical gardens exude an otherworldly charm, serving as a sanctuary for both flora and fauna. The Magnolia Plantation and Gardens offers meandering paths through lush greenery and vibrant floral displays. As visitors meander through, one may encounter scenic ponds, hidden nooks, and intricately designed landscapes that evoke a sense of tranquility. These gardens are not merely places to visit; they are immersive experiences that connect individuals to nature’s resplendence.

Cultural Venues

Charleston Cultural Venues Map

Beyond its picturesque landscapes, Charleston also thrives as a cultural hub. Museums and art galleries dot the city, showcasing local talent and historical artifacts. The Gibbes Museum of Art is an epitome of Charleston’s artistic spirit, featuring a fine collection of Southern art that reflects the city’s rich cultural tapestry. Engaging with these venues enriches one’s understanding of Charleston’s heritage and contemporary creativity.
